Coroutine awaitables

The second part of the support is provided by header <boost/outcome/coroutine_support.hpp> (or <boost/outcome/experimental/coroutine_support.hpp> if you want Coroutine support for Experimental Outcome). This adds into namespace BOOST_OUTCOME_V2_NAMESPACE::awaitables (or BOOST_OUTCOME_V2_NAMESPACE::experimental::awaitables) these awaitable types suitable for returning from a Coroutinised function:

